At Rebound, we’re committed to providing compassionate, evidence-based ABA services to individuals with autism and developmental differences. We believe in supporting families and creating an inclusive, empowering environment for our clients and staff alike. As we grow, we’re looking for an Office Manager & Scheduler to keep our clinic running smoothly behind the scenes, someone who is both organized and people-centered.
In this role, you’ll be the go-to person for scheduling therapy sessions, coordinating staff availability, and ensuring our clients receive consistent, timely care. You’ll manage calendars for our team of Behavior Technicians and BCBAs, adjusting sessions when things shift (and they will). Your communication skills will be critical as you interface daily with families, staff, and leadership. You’ll also help with day-to-day office tasks like answering phones, responding to emails, tracking documentation, and maintaining a welcoming front-desk environment.
Because we’re a close-knit team, flexibility is key. There may be times when you’re needed to step in and work directly with clients as a temporary fill-in, especially if you have experience or interest in ABA or child development. If you’re comfortable being in the therapy room and supporting kids when needed, we consider that a huge plus.
The ideal candidate is highly organized, quick on their feet, and confident juggling many moving pieces. Experience in scheduling or healthcare administration is preferred, and familiarity with ABA clinics, HIPAA compliance, or scheduling software is even better. You should feel comfortable communicating with families, supporting clinical staff, and maintaining confidentiality in a fast-paced setting.
This is a full-time, on-site role with regular weekday hours. Some flexibility may be needed to accommodate evening or weekend sessions on occasion. We offer competitive compensation, a supportive environment, and the chance to be part of meaningful work that truly changes lives.
